Squirrel Mail is a good balance between both of NeoMail and Horde in features and accessibility.
All of the buttons and text within are pretty self explanatory on what they do.
Simply visit www.yourwebsite.com/webmail and log in with your username (the email address itself) and password and you're in. It's easy.
Warnings
- Do not rely on Squirrel Mail as your primary method of email. If your box gets too large, your email will suffer.
- Do not send emails to more than a dozen people. If you need to send mass emails, please use the email marketing services. Sending bulk emails from your account may result in account termination.
Recommendations
- Go into the settings and increase the number of emails you can see on a given page.
- Delete your spam and junk filter from time to time (click "purge")
- Create folders and move your emails into the folders once they are read and done with. For example, make one folder for each client or associate and place it in there when you are done.
